    Yeah durries (as we sometimes call them) are pretty expensive here.. A few years ago the government put about 80% tax on them to try to get people to stop smoking (and obviously make money off the people who couldn’t/wouldn’t).

    Just to give people an idea – a pack of cigarettes here costs around $10-14. Thats about 6 EURO or around 8 USD. I remember when they used to be $3 a pack.

    The governemnt is trying hard to get people to stop smoking. In fact, the local councils are introducing laws now where you aren’t allowed to smoke outside any cafes or at bus stops etc. Soon the only place you will be able to smoke is in your own home – but don’t get caught outside or you will get fined.

    Seriously though, it’s good that instead of only putting the tax so high on cigarettes they are trying to do something about it. Otherwise they would just look like they wanted the tax money.. sounds like another government I know.
